what can baking powder be used for?

Baking powder is a leavening agent, a substance that causes baked goods to rise. It is a mixture of sodium bicarbonate, an acid, and a starch. When baking powder is mixed with a liquid, the acid and sodium bicarbonate react, releasing carbon dioxide gas. This gas creates bubbles in the batter or dough, which causes it to rise. Baking powder is used in a variety of baked goods, including cakes, cookies, muffins, and quick breads. It can also be used in pancakes, waffles, and other batter-based foods. Baking powder is a convenient and effective way to add leavening to baked goods. It is easy to use and does not require any special skills or equipment. what happens if you put baking soda in your private parts?

Baking soda, a common household item, is often used for various cleaning and deodorizing purposes. However, using it in your private parts can be harmful and lead to several health risks. The delicate pH balance of the vagina is crucial for maintaining a healthy environment and preventing infections. Baking soda is highly alkaline and can disrupt this pH balance, making it more susceptible to infections and irritation. Additionally, baking soda can cause dryness, itching, and discomfort due to its abrasive nature. If you experience any discomfort or irritation after using baking soda, it’s essential to consult a healthcare professional immediately.

can i use baking soda and lemon on my face everyday?

Baking soda and lemon are common household items that are often used for cleaning and skincare. While they can be effective in certain applications, it’s important to use them with caution on your face. Baking soda is a mild abrasive that can irritate and dry out your skin, while lemon juice can cause sun sensitivity and discoloration. If you do choose to use these ingredients, it’s best to do so sparingly and avoid using them every day. A better option for daily facial care is a gentle cleanser and moisturizer that is designed for your skin type.
